Figures from the Florida … WebThere are 267 cities, 123 towns, and 21 villages in the U.S. state of Florida, a total of 411 municipalities. [1] They are distributed across 67 counties, in addition to 66 county governments. [2] Jacksonville has the only consolidated city–county government in the state, [3] so there is no Duval County government.
